In this class you will create your own unique galaxy… with watercolours!
Get lost in the stars and enjoy a relaxing and mindful painting class.
Learn how to play with the fluidity of watercolours and mix tones together to create a beautiful cloudy galaxy. Add some stars, constellations or other celestial bodies of your choice.
Create your own personal watercolour to brighten your home and get the skills to create many more.
This workshop will cover:
- what materials are good to use
- effects with watercolours – creating that interstellar feel.
Who will be teaching?
Jess Wilson (Dubblu) she/her is a multidisciplinary artist, illustrator and muralist based in Footscray. Her work focuses on immersive experiences, employing a variety of techniques from audio, animation and sensory.
If she can convince her audience to climb into a pipe or crawl on the ground she considers it to be a success. She is the Creative Designer for Science Play Kids, as well as a workshop facilitator to make science and art accessible for all.
